This 160-acre ranch offers a rare opportunity to own a well-rounded property in the highly sought-after Jim Ned School District, just 9 miles south of Abilene. With a great combination of usability, location, and potential, this tract fits a variety of buyers—from those looking for a private homestead to investors considering future development. The land features gently rolling terrain with a healthy mix of clay and sandy loam soils, making it suitable for both grazing and improved pasture. Good perimeter fencing is already in place, and two stock tanks, along with a wet weather creek, provide natural water sources for livestock and wildlife. Utilities are conveniently available, with Taylor Electric running along the south fence line and Steamboat Mountain Water possibly accessible along CR 154 (a feasibility study needed), making future building or development more straightforward. Enjoy wide-open West Texas views, including scenic sights of Steamboat Mountain, along with peaceful sunsets that make country living so appealing. While the setting offers privacy and space, you’re still only 10–15 minutes from Abilene’s restaurants, shopping, and colleges. With its location in a growing area and strong access to utilities, this property also presents an excellent opportunity for future subdivision or development into a new residential community. Whether you’re looking to build, run cattle, invest, or simply enjoy a piece of West Texas, this 160-acre ranch checks all the boxes. Seller will divide in 2 80AC tracts.
